How much do remote free copywriting j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ote free copywriting in the United States is $36.74,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$27.88 and $41.59 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Remote Free Copywriting and Remote Content Writer roles often overlap but differ mainly in focus. Copywriters typically craft persuasive, marketing-oriented content, while content writers produce informational or research-based material. Both roles require strong writing skills and can be freelance or remote, but copywriters often focus on branding and advertising, whereas content writers may work across various industries like media or publishing.

Job Summary

The Lead Graphic Designer, Digital Marketing is a senior individual contributor who elevates the quality and consistency of digital marketing design across the team. This role does not carry direct management responsibilities — there are no direct reports, performance reviews, or hiring duties attached to it. 

What sets this role apart is scope and influence. The Graphic Design Lead owns the most complex digital marketing projects, sets the art direction standard for the channel, mentors peer designers, and represents the Design team in cross-functional conversations with Marketing and channel partners. This person leads through example, expertise, and initiative — not title. 

This person thrives in a fast-paced, high-volume environment and brings both strong design craft and an understanding of how digital assets perform across platforms.
